What is a Highmark?

Highmark is a large health insurance company based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It offers a variety of health insurance plans for individuals, families, and employers, as well as Medicare and Medicaid services. Highmark is affiliated with the Blue Cross Blue Shield Association and serves millions of members across several states. In addition to insurance, Highmark provides services in dental, vision, and other areas of healthcare management.

THE ROLE

We are looking for a Venue Technology Assistant tojoinourteam at Highmark Stadium in Buffalo, NY. As a Venue Tech Assistant, you will providetimelyandprofessional ITsupportfor food and beverage and retail systems for Highmark Stadium.If you are looking to be a part of the excitement and energy of live stadium events, this is your opportunity to join a fast-paced and team-oriented environment!

Opening in the 2026 NFL season,thenew Highmark Stadium will become the home of the Buffalo Bills. As the largest construction project in Western New York history, this stadium will havestate-of-the-arttechnology that will enhance the fan experience. Join us as we remember the past, while looking forward to the future.

ESSENTIALFUNCTIONS

  • Install,maintain, and troubleshootpoint of salesystems, including terminals, receipt printers, scanners, and payment devices

  • Replace defective hardwareas needed

  • Conduct stadium walk-throughsto ensure all systems are operational prior to and during all events

  • Provide basic network support, including troubleshooting connectivity issues for wired and wireless devices

  • Practice safe work habits, follow all safetypolicies and proceduresand regulations, complete company-wide safetytrainingand anyadditionaljob specific safety training

  • Completeother duties as assignedby management

About ASM Global

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

ASM Global was formed in October 2019 from the merger of AEG Facilities, the global innovator in live entertainment venues, and SMG, the gold standard in event management. ASM Global is a venue management powerhouse that spans five continents, 14 countries and more than 300 of the world's most prestigious arenas, stadiums, convention and exhibit centers, and performing arts venues. As the world's most trusted venue manager, ASM Global provides venue strategy and management, sales, marketing, event booking and programming, construction and design consulting, and pre-opening services. Among the venues in our portfolio are landmark facilities such as McCormick Place & Soldier Field in Chicago, the Los Angeles Convention Center, Tele2 Arena in Stockholm, the Mercedes-Benz Superdome in New Orleans, the Shenzhen World Exhibition and Conference Centre in Shenzhen, China and Van Andel Arena, DeVos Place & DeVos Performance Hall in Grand Rapids, Michigan. ASM Global also offers food and beverage operations through its concessions and catering companies.
